`discussions[]` entries:
| Field | Type | Required | Notes |
|---|---|:---:|---|
| `day` | integer | yes | SPC outlook day, currently `1`, `2`, or `3`. |
| `headline` | string | no | Matching Day 1-3 print-page product title. |
| `summary` | string | no | Text from the print-page `...SUMMARY...` section. |
| `discussion` | string | no | Cleaned full print-page product text. |
| `updatedAt` | timestamp | no | Print-page update time, when present. |
When no SPC polygons apply locally, the run is still emitted with `outlooks: []`
and `discussions: []`. Discussions are included only for days represented by at
least one retained outlook, and multiple retained outlook types for the same day
share one discussion entry.
### SPC Outlook Supersession
Consumers should prefer latest-run semantics for current conditions: read the
latest `WeatherOutlookRun` for the configured location and use its `outlooks`
and `discussions` arrays together.
Historical SQL consumers that collapse older rows should identify superseded
outlooks by `provider`, `product`, `outlookType`, `validFrom`, and `validTo`,
then keep rows with the greatest `issuedAt`. `day` and `label` are not identity
fields. When multiple retained polygons share that latest `issuedAt`, preserve
the full group.
## Legacy `weather.outlook.v1`
`weather.outlook.v1` is a historical canonical schema retained as a standards
constant for older data and consumers. Current SPC normalization emits
`weather.outlook.v2`.
The v1 payload used `WeatherOutlookRun` and placed `headline`, `summary`, and
`discussion` on each `outlooks[]` polygon. It also represented the pre-v2 SPC
canonical behavior, where national polygons were preserved in canonical output.

## Mapping Notes
Each GeoJSON feature becomes one canonical outlook. Products are ordered by day,
then categorical, tornado, hail, and wind. Feature order is preserved within
each product.
The raw source fetches and envelopes the complete SPC bundle. The normalizer
decodes every configured GeoJSON product, skips empty no-risk
`GeometryCollection` placeholders, and emits canonical outlooks only when the
configured point is inside or on the boundary of a real feature. Products are
ordered by day, then categorical, tornado, hail, and wind. Retained feature order
is preserved within each product.
The normalizer computes `containsLocation` with the configured latitude and
longitude against compact GeoJSON `Polygon` or `MultiPolygon` geometry.
Coordinates use GeoJSON order, `[longitude, latitude]`, and boundary points
count as contained.
All outlook polygons are preserved, including polygons that do not contain the
configured point. Matching print-page headline, summary, and discussion text is
attached to every outlook for the same day.
Canonical outlook runs are emitted even when no polygons apply locally. In that
case the payload contains empty `outlooks` and `discussions` arrays.
Print-page prose is represented as run-level day discussions. Discussions are
included only for days represented by at least one retained outlook. Multiple
retained outlook types for the same day share one discussion entry.
For downstream current-state and historical supersession guidance, see the
[event wire contract](events.md#spc-outlook-supersession).
